Sailing to Estancia Harberton offers visitors the chance to discover the fascinating history of the oldest Estancia in the region. We will visit its facilities and surroundings, while learning about the activities that take place there. The tour is completed with a navigation through the Beagle Channel, which will take us through several points of interest, such as the Les Eclaireurs Lighthouse, and several islands where we can see sea lions and several species of birds
After the pick up from the hotels, we will leave the tourist pier to sail the Beagle Channel, observing the Argentinean coasts and on the opposite side, the Navarino Island (Chile). We will arrive at Les Eclaireurs Lighthouse, emblem of Ushuaia. Continue to Isla Martillo, where we will observe a small colony of penguins.
Later we will disembark at the Harberton Estancia dock, the oldest in the region, to take a walk through the facilities and learn about its activities. We will be able to visit the old part of the ranch, getting excellent views of the bay, mountains and islands of the southeast of the canal. Once again, we will embark to return to Ushuaia and we will pass through some islets where sea lions will be appreciated in one and a diversity of birds in another. Arrival in Ushuaia Drop off at your hotel after the tour
